Output 42eafac3bfb456bbe49695579e5530552a044207c083c37ff05b5b2c8e61bc4d:1

value
486592196
script pubkey
OP_0 OP_PUSHBYTES_20 51c3505b00304c1ea101a8b54f9b7c5d743e409c
address
bc1q28p4qkcqxpxpaggp4z65lxmut46rusyuacne89
transaction
42eafac3bfb456bbe49695579e5530552a044207c083c37ff05b5b2c8e61bc4d
confirmations
269993
spent
true